QUOTE (Penta @ Apr 24 2010, 05:49 AM) *
Problem: What's their seakeeping like? Keep in mind, you'll be out in the North Atlantic. It would suck to get a helipad, only to be unable to handle rough seas.


Pontoon boats, I don't know. Catamarans are regularly used for high seas sailing, and SWATH boats are used by the US Navy and others for all uses. SWATH boats are actually super stable, which is their primary advantage; their main downside is being slow and fuel inefficient (they have a relatively high underwater profile, creating lots of drag).
